Discovering Different Categories of Pearls

Though pearl earrings can elevate any jewelry collection, understanding the different types of pearls is vital for making an informed purchase. Pearls are categorized primarily into three types: natural, cultured, and imitation. Natural pearls form naturally in the wild, making them extremely rare and often expensive. Cultured pearls, conversely, are formed through human intervention, where a bead is inserted into an oyster or mollusk to stimulate pearl production. This category includes Akoya, Tahitian, and South Sea pearls, each varying in size, color, and luster. Imitation pearls, typically made from glass or plastic, imitate the appearance of real pearls but lack the unique qualities of genuine pearls. Additionally, the luster, surface quality, and shape of pearls can substantially affect their overall value and appeal. Buyers should familiarize themselves with these distinctions to select the perfect pair of pearl earrings that match their preferences and budget.

Assessing Quality: What to Watch For

When assessing the quality of pearl earrings, two key factors stand out: luster and surface imperfections. Luster denotes the reflective quality of the pearls, which can significantly affect their overall appeal. Furthermore, a careful examination of surface imperfections is vital, as these flaws can reduce the value and beauty of the earrings.

Radiance and Shine

Shine and luster are vital attributes that determine the attraction of pearl earrings. These attributes originate from the layers of nacre that form around the pearl's nucleus, affecting its overall beauty. A high-quality pearl will display a intense, reflective luster that intensifies its color and richness. When examining pearls, one should look for a luminous, luminous surface that absorbs light magnificently. The finest pearls will have a lustrous appearance, allowing colors to appear rich and dynamic. It is crucial to note that luster closely relates with the pearl's quality; superior pearls will reflect light more intensely than substandard options. Consequently, discerning buyers should concentrate on luster and shine when choosing the perfect pair of pearl earrings to ensure lasting elegance.

Picking the Right Size and Shape

Choosing the correct size and shape of pearl earrings is essential for achieving the desired aesthetic and ensuring comfort. The size of pearls commonly ranges from 3mm to 20mm, with larger pearls offering a bolder statement while smaller ones offer subtle elegance. Those with delicate features may find smaller pearls more flattering, whereas those with more prominent facial structures might prefer larger selections.

In terms of shape, pearls exist in various forms, such as round, oval, baroque, and drop. Round pearls are versatile and classic, often appropriate for formal occasions. Oval and drop shapes can provide a unique flair, while baroque pearls provide an artistic touch with their asymmetrical forms.

Ultimately, one's personal preferences and the occasion should guide the decision. Harmonizing size and shape with personal tastes guarantees that the chosen pearl earrings complement one's overall appearance without diminishing comfort.

Taking Care of Your Pearl Earrings

Routine care is vital for maintaining the radiance and durability of pearl earrings. Pearls are delicate and require special care to preserve their luster. After wearing them, it is wise to gently wipe down the pearls with a dry, soft cloth to remove any oil or residue. This simple step helps avoid deterioration and discoloration.

Storing pearls correctly is equally essential; pearls need to be maintained in a soft cloth bag or lined jewelry container to avoid scratches from firmer items. They ought not to be placed in a humid environment or direct sunlight, as both may damage their luster.

Prevent exposure of pearl earrings from cosmetics, perfumes, or hairsprays, as these products can damage the surface. Additionally, routine checks for loose settings or signs of wear can help address potential issues before they worsen. By implementing these care guidelines, one can ensure that pearl earrings remain a timeless accessory for years to come.
